To get started with this particular recipe, we have to prepare a few ingredients. You can have Soft-baked pretzels & homemade nacho cheese sauce using 16 ingredients and 16 steps. Here is how you cook it.
Ingredients and spices that need to be Make ready to make Soft-baked pretzels & homemade nacho cheese sauce:
- 4 cups flour
- 2.25 tsp instant yeast
- 1.5 cups warm water (approx 105F)
- 1 tbsp brown sugar
- 1 tbsp unsalted butter
- Coarse salt
- 9 cups water
- 1/2 cup baking soda
- Nacho cheese sauce
- 2 cups cheddar cheese
- 1/4 cup unsalted butter
- 1/4 cup flour
- 2 cups milk
- 1.5 Tbsp hot sauce
- 1/4 tsp cayenne
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ions to make Soft-baked pretzels & homemade nacho cheese sauce
- Whisk instant yeast and water. Let sit for 2 minutes
- Whisk in salt, brown sugar and 1 tbsp of melted butter
- Slowly add in the flour 1 cup at a time while needing the dough using a dough hook.
- Once ready (no longer sticky), place the dough on a floured surface and knead for 5 minutes by hand.
- Shape into a ball and cover with a towel for 10 minutes
- In the mean time preheat oven to 400F and bring the baking soda and water to a boil. Grease parchment paper with butter.
- Cut dough into 12 peices and roll each of them into a 30 cm rope. Form a circle with the dough by bringing the 2 ends together at the top of the circle. Twist the ends together and bring them back down towards yourself. Press them down to form a pretzel shape.
- Once all are formed. Drop each pretzel into the boiling water one at a time for 20 seconds each. Do not exceed 20 seconds or you will have a metallic taste in your pretzel.
- Place pretzel on baking sheet. Sprinkle with coarse salt. (Less is more)
- Bake for 15 minutes
- Remove from oven and let cool
- Melt 1/4 cup of butter in a saucepan
- Add flour and stir constantly.
- Add milk stirring constantly until sauce thickens
- Add cheddar cheese and let it melt.then add hot sauce, cayenne and salt and pepper.
